Dripping Taps



Leaky faucets can be a frustrating nuisance for house owners. These relentless drips not only produce an irritating noise yet also cause squandered water and enhanced utility expenses. A leaky tap commonly arises from worn-out washers, O-rings, or seals, which deteriorate with time due to normal usage and exposure to water. In many cases, the tap's interior components may be worn away or harmed, requiring a much more substantial repair work or replacement. Identifying the resource of the leak is important; property owners might require to disassemble the faucet to analyze its components closely. Regular upkeep can assist avoid leakages, consisting of cleaning aerators and looking for indicators of wear. Attending to a leaky tap immediately can save water and reduce prices, making it a workable yet essential job for house owners to tackle in keeping their pipes systems efficiently. Proper interest to this common concern can result in a more comfy living environment.


Obstructed Drains



Many house owners experience the frustration of clogged up drains at some time. This common pipes issue can develop from various reasons, including the buildup of hair, soap residue, food particles, and oil. These materials can create obstructions that hinder the flow of water, bring about slow drain or full stoppage.In kitchen areas, oil and food scraps are often the offenders, while bathrooms often experience hair and soap buildup. Routine upkeep, such as using drain filters and staying clear of pouring fats down the sink, can assist protect against clogs.When a clog does happen, home owners may attempt to utilize a bettor or a commercial drain cleaner as preliminary solutions. Relentless concerns may require expert help to stay clear of damages to pipes. Comprehending the reasons and avoidance methods for blocked drains can save house owners time and cash, making certain a smoother pipes experience

Sources Of Running Toilets



A persistent circulation of water from a commode can be both inefficient and aggravating, often signaling underlying issues within the plumbing system. One common cause is a worn flapper valve, which may not create a proper seal, allowing water to continuously leak right into the dish. In addition, a malfunctioning fill shutoff can lead to excessive water circulation, adding to the trouble. Misaligned float devices might additionally trigger the bathroom to run as they stop working to control the water level properly. Another possible problem is mineral buildup, which can block elements and hinder their capability. Determining these causes promptly can aid house owners deal with the issue prior to it rises, ensuring reliable procedure of their pipes system.

Fixing Running Bathroom Issues



Commodes that continuously run can be an irritating issue for homeowners, but determining the More Help reason is the very first step toward a reliable fix. Common causes include a defective flapper, which may not develop a correct seal, permitting water to escape right into the bowl. If necessary, homeowners ought to inspect the flapper for wear and change it. In addition, the fill shutoff might be malfunctioning, triggering excess water to stream constantly. Replacing this component or adjusting might resolve the concern. An additional possible wrongdoer is a misaligned float, which can be adapted to the right height. Burst Pipeline



Burst pipelines can be a significant pipes problem, commonly arising from the very same factors that contribute to low water stress, such as temperature level variations and aging infrastructure. When water freezes within pipes, it broadens, boosting stress till the pipeline can no more contain it, resulting in a tear. In addition, deterioration from long term direct exposure to water can deteriorate pipes, making them vulnerable to rupturing under typical pressure.Homeowners may observe indications of a ruptured pipe with abrupt water leakages, damp places on ceilings or wall surfaces, and an unanticipated rise in their water costs. Immediate activity is essential; failing to address a ruptured pipeline can cause considerable water damages, mold and mildew growth, and expensive repair work. Regular inspections and upkeep of pipes systems can assist avoid this issue. Insulating pipelines in cooler areas and changing old piping can considerably minimize the risk of ruptured pipes, guarding the home's pipes integrity.



Water Heater Issues



Exactly how can homeowners identify water heating system problems prior to they intensify? Regular assessment and maintenance can assist spot possible problems early. Home owners ought to seek indications such as irregular water temperature level, unusual sounds, or a decline in hot water supply. Leakages or puddles around the system might suggest a breakdown that requires instant focus. The appearance of corrosion or debris accumulation can likewise indicate the requirement for maintenance.Additionally, home owners ought to keep an eye on the age of their water heater; most systems have a life-span of 8 to 12 years. It might be time to reflect on replacement if the heating unit is approaching this age and revealing indicators of wear. Regular flushing of the tank can stop debris accumulation, extending the device's life. By remaining alert and resolving issues quickly, house owners can stay clear of pricey repairs and guarantee their hot water heater operates effectively for several years ahead.


Sewage System Line Problems



Many homeowners may experience sewer line problems at some time, affecting their plumbing system's total performance. Common concerns consist of clogs, tree root intrusions, and pipe damages. Clogs often arise from the buildup of oil, hair, and international items that obstruct the flow of wastewater. click this Tree origins can penetrate sewage system lines, creating leakages and cracks. Furthermore, aging pipes may damage or rust, causing additional problems (Plumbers Near Me). Indicators of drain line problem include slow-moving drains, undesirable odors, and sewage back-ups, which can pose wellness risks. House owners should attend to these problems promptly to stay clear of substantial damage and pricey repair services. Routine maintenance, such as set up assessments and cleaning, can aid protect against considerable problems. In serious cases, professional treatment may be essential to fix or change damaged sections of the sewage system line. Being mindful of these possible troubles can help home owners take aggressive procedures to preserve their pipes systems successfully

What Are the Signs of Hidden Pipes Leaks?



Indications of hidden pipes leaks include inexplicable water expenses, damp places on wall surfaces or ceilings, mold and mildew growth, and a musty smell. These signs frequently recommend underlying problems that need specialist evaluation and repair work for resolution.


Just how Typically Should I Have My Plumbing Inspected?



Normal plumbing inspections are recommended each to 2 years. This regularity helps recognize potential concerns early, making sure the system remains effective and reducing the threat of expensive repair work or unanticipated emergencies in the future.
